Where to find the Fortune Teller

To do fortune telling in Persona 3 Reload, you need to head over to Club Escapade in Paulownia Mall. To enter this establishment, you’ll need to have at least the second level of Courage. Afterward, you’ll be able to enter the club during the evening. Once inside, you’ll find the fortune teller just to the right of the dancefloor. She’s also marked on your map by a little crystal ball icon.

The Fortune Teller can either read your fortune or your future. The latter choice is just her spouting some vague phrases about the current story beat. But the fortune option allows you to alter the kind of enemies that appear in Tartarus. This is useful for when you need to grind out some extra money or experience. How to complete Request 8

To complete Elizabeth’s request: Experiment with fortune telling, make sure you pick it up before doing anything else. Some requests can technically be completed without acquiring them from Elizabeth first, but not this one. Once you’ve done that, head over to the Fortune Teller and select the Rarity Fortune option. Afterward, all you need to do is venture into Tartarus until you see a rare enemy appear.

The rare enemy will be the little golden shadow that sometimes appears randomly during exploration anyway. Once you beat this shadow all you need to do is head back to Elizabeth and hand the Request in. And that’s all there is to it.
